Politics of Special Status
Political parties in Jharkhand are demanding and lobbying for it to be declared a “Special Status State”. However, it is not very clear how the state will benefit from such a status. The political parties feel that the higher budgetary allocation that this will lead to the state will make a difference with development work and the creation of infrastructure. However, this seems a distant dream, particularly in a state where corruption is institutionalised from top to bottom, where the state is not able to spend even the allocated budget, and where political parties and their leaderships do not seem to have commitment and vision for the state. In
such a situation, the grant of a special status will only increase corruption and loot by the politicians, middlemen, and bureaucrats. An increase in corruption would well impoverish the state and its people further.
